14) Viewing Files

Most criminal and civil files are public records and may be viewed in the clerk's office during office hours, unless they have been ordered sealed by the court. Juvenile records are closed to the public. A driver's license or photo ID is required as a deposit to view a record. Because storage space is limited, most closed files are located off site. Requests to view files located off site should be made at least two weeks in advance.
